For what values of x, the terms `4/3`, x, `4/27` are in G.P.?

उत्तर

`4/3`, x, `4/27` are in Geometric progression

∴ `"t"_2/"t"_1 = "t"_3/"t"_2`

∴ `"x"/(4/3) = (4/27)/"x"`

∴ x2 = `4/3 xx 4/27`

∴ x2 = `16/81`

∴ x = `± 4/9`
